Robby Hall wins inaugural Tony Vyskocil 31 Up Memorial Trophy

West Kirby Victoria's Robby Hall beat club mate Dave Gilmore 31-27 in an excellent final after a dramatic day's bowling in the first Tony Vyskocil 31 Up Memorial Trophy Competition held at Manor Road this afternoon. Robby bowled consistently well all afternoon and came through 2 titanic struggles against Geoff Lynch 31-30 in the Quarter Finals and then Mark Lynch 31-29 in the semi finals before another hard match in the Final against Dave Gilmore. Robby had certainly proved not only his great ability but also his great fitness to come through these tough matches to claim the Trophy. There was another amazing Quarter Final match that saw Mark Lynch finally overcome his Queens Royal team mate Craig Saville 31-30 in a superb game. Dave had accounted for Alan Bainbridge and Ian Hazlehurst in his Quarter and Semi Final matches to have a more comfortable entry into the Final. The real reason behind the event however was to commemorate the tragic passing of Tony Vyskocil last year and Tony's parents donated a magnificent Trophy to be played for Annually by the District's bowlers. Tony's mother presented the Trophy to Robby Hall at an emotional presentation ceremony witnessed by Tony's partner and their son, Roy, as well as Tony's dad.

"Buzz" light years ahead of opponents in charge to Wallasey Merit Title triumph

Anthony Thompson proved too strong for his opponents in a terrific night's bowling, that saw him win the Wallasey Individual Merit Title at Manor Road last night with a fine 21-13 victory in the Final against West Kirby Victoria team mate John Devlin. "Buzz" provided what might have been described as the best win of the night in his quarter final match against the remarkably consistent Mark Lynch, when after taking an early 12-04 lead and being pulled back by Mark to 17-17, he managed to take 4 of the last 5 points to run out an excellent 21-18 winner. John Devlin had a topsy turvey 21-20 win over Mike Nelson in his quarter final match when after building a big early lead he found himself 19-20 down only to pull out 2 singles at the end to send Mike out, with Mike putting his last wood through the narrowest of gaps between John's wood and the jack to unluckily lose out. The other 2 quarter final matches saw Dave Gilmore defeat John Lloyd 21-08 and Matty Gilmore defeat Geoff Lynch 21-11. The semi finals were both excellent matches with Anthony Thompson coming back from an early 03-06 deficit against Dave Gilmore to eventually go 09-06 up and keep ahead right through to the end and a fine 21-17 victory. John Devlin caused a surprise in his semi final against Matty Gilmore when after being 03-09 down he went 11-09 up and 17-11 up before running out a deserved 21-15 winner after proving almost impassable on a short mark across the green in front of the new Manor Road extension. The final saw Anthony Thompson stride into an early 08-01 lead before being pegged back to 08-09 by John but a run of 10 shots up and down the centre of the green saw Anthony take a 19-09 lead before John managed a run of 4 more to lie at 13-19, Anthony then took the 2 singles required to put his name on the famous old trophy for the first time.

North Derbyshire County Match postponed until September 16th

The British Parks Senior County Championship Division Two match between Wallasey and North Derbyshire has had to be re-arranged because of a clash with the North Derbyshire Senior Individual Merit Championship, in which the majority of the North Derbyshire players will be playing. This match has now been arranged for Sunday September 16th with venue details to be announced nearer the date. Contrary to reports last week that North Derbyshire had beaten Warwickshire to ensure that both ourselves and North Derbyshire were promoted, the match was actually postponed because of the severe weather conditions in the Warwickshire area with travel in and out of Birmingham severely restricted because of heavy flooding. The North Derbyshire / Warwickshire match will now be played on Sunday September 23rd.

Great Meols retain Sheppick Cup with 36 shot defeat of Grange at Quarry Vikings tonight.

There was a minor miracle tonight when our daily intake of heavy rain this Summer abated between the hours of 6-00pm to 9-00pm to enable Great Meols to retain the Sheppick Cup with a 36 shot defeat of Grange at a heavy Quarry Vikings green. In fact I think Grange were so unused to bowling in the fleeting glimpses of sunshine, that they were overpowered by 8 winners to 4 in a match containing many good performances by both sides. Great Meols took an early 11 shot lead despite both sides having 2 winners each in the first 4 blocks. Steve Casey 21-20 and Mike Casey 21-12 were the two Grange winners but Mick Miller 21-15 and an excellent 21-06 from Dave Gray saw Great Meols take a lead they never lost all night. With only a fine display from John McLoughlin for Grange, who won 21-13, to offset Derek Thomas's 21-12, Tony Cavanagh's 21-17 and another excellent 21-07 winning card from Lenny Wade for Great Meols, the score after 8 blocks stood at 150-120 for Great Meols. There were four exciting and close games in the back four but once again Great Meols had 3 winners to only 1 from Grange.  Les Pate 21-17, Bill Purcell 21-19 and Andy Smith 21-17 claimed good wins for Great Meols with John Barke's 21-17 win being the only response from Grange. At the end of the night Great Meols ran out worthy winners by 230 shots to 194 and Captain, Arthur Fagan gratefully received the Cup from Association President, Keith Etches.

Promotion for Wallasey Association in British Parks Senior County Championship

The Wallasey County sides had big home and away wins against Cheshire this afternoon to clinch promotion to Division One next season with a match still to play against North Derbyshire next month. The home side won 11 points to 3 at Quarry Vikings Bowling Club with the away side winning 10 points to 4 at Love Lane Park, Stockport. With the 3 aggregate points available the final score was a resounding 24 points to 7 victory for Wallasey. In the home match Bill Astles 21-04, Anthony Thompson 21-06 and Dave Gilmore 21-08 were the big winners and with 9 winners in total for Wallasey, Cheshire were comprehensively despatched back up the M56 to Stockport. The away side at Love Lane Park, Stockport had 8 winners on the day with Eddie Dutton, fresh from his heroics in the Harold Jones Cup Final last night, leading the way with a commanding 21-03 victory that was closely followed by Neil Sherbrooke's  21-06 win. Craig Bourbonneux had a good 21-10 win and Bill Atkinson had a fine 21-12 winning card to leave Wallasey travelling back to Wallasey in fine fettle despite the lousy weather experienced all afternoon. A special word of thanks must go to Rick Keeley who stepped in as Referee in the away leg at short notice and did a top class job in the difficult conditions. Pulsating Night's Bowls Sees Harold Jones Cup Final Go To A Replay

The top two Wallasey Association Teams at the moment, West Kirby Victoria and Queens Royal, served up a treat for a big crowd at Manor Road tonight, when the Harold Jones Cup Final finished with both sides on 218 after a terrific match played in an excellent sporting spirit by both sides. On the superb Manor Road green Anthony Thompson 21-16 and Dave Gilmore 21-20 put West Kirby into an early lead but this was pulled back by Mark Lynch winning 21-15 for Queens Royal. Steve Nugent came off with a 21-15 winning scorecard for West Kirby to leave the scores level at 78 each after 4 blocks (Queens Royal receiving a 6 shot start from the handicappers). Queens Royal then stormed into a 27 shot lead after having 3 winning cards in the middle four with Craig Saville and Eddie Dutton giving superb displays with 21-10 and 21-06 wins respectively. Karl Sherbrooke pulled 1 shot back for West Kirby with a narrow 21-20 win but this was undone when Geoff Lynch came off with a 21-19 win for Royal after finishing with 3 two's from 15-19 down. The score after 8 blocks being 161-134 in favour of Queens Royal meant that West Kirby needed a big winner in the back four and once again it was Matt Gilmore who came up trumps with a quick fire 21-07 success followed by the Fitzpatrick brothers, Jamie and Robby, both winning 21-16 to leave West Kirby in the driving seat with Robby Hall leading 17-05 in his match with Frank O'Neill but Frank staged a terrific comeback to eventually only lose out 18-21 and leave the final scores 218-218 after some wonderful bowling that was a credit to both sides.  The likely replay date is Saturday August 4th but this will be confirmed as soon as arrangements have been made.

Manor Road "C" take Association Cup with narrow nine shot defeat of Royden Hall in excellent final.

Manor Road "C" won the Association Cup tonight when they defeated Royden Hall 210-201 in an excellent final played in a fine sporting manner at the Wallasey Royal British Legion green. The opening four blocks saw four good close games with Tony Hughes 21-18 and John Leece 21-17 winning for Royden Hall and Bob Hughes 21-20 and Carol Dunne 21-15 winning for Manor Road "C",  leaving the scores tied at 77 each. Royden Hall forged 10 shots ahead after the middle four with 3 winners, Bill Braidford 21-15, Geoff Foster 21-16 and Dave Bullock, an excellent 21-09, offset only by John Molley's equally excellent 21-08 victory for Manor Road "C", to leave the scores 148-138 to Royden Hall. With two winners each in the last four it was Jim Hulican's comprehensive 21-04 victory and Mark Bainbridge's comfortable 21-07 win that turned the tide Manor Road's way and despite Gerry Jones winning 21-16 and Alan Storey's 21-14 victory they could not match the two crucial Manor Road single figure wins, leaving Manor Road "C" eventual 210-201 winners and jubilantly claiming the Cup for the first time since 1993. A shy but proud Manor Road "C" Captain, Mrs. Rose Hughes, collected the Cup from Association President, Keith Etches. Plaudits must go to both sides for providing such a sporting match for the good crowd of spectators present.

Tragic loss as bowler dies during match at Manor Road.

It is with great regret that I have to report the tragic loss of Sam Hoey, who collapsed and died whilst playing for Marine Park "B" against Manor Road "C" at Manor Road on Wednesday night. All seemed well as Sam had been playing for approximately 15 minutes when suddenly he collapsed on the green and despite heroic attempts by two ladies from inside the Manor Road Club and Marine Park bowler Gary Abbott, to resuscitate him, Sam did not regain consciousness and unfortunately was pronounced dead at Arrowe Park Hospital. All our sympathies and condolences go to Sam's family and funeral arrangements will be posted as soon as I know anything.
